- The distance between Carolina, Brazil and Ballinger, Tx, Usa is approximately 7,058 km or 4,386 mi.
- To reach Carolina in this distance one would set out from Ballinger, Tx bearing 118.5°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Carolina bearing 131.1° or SE .
- Carolina has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Ballinger, Tx has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Carolina is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Ballinger, Tx is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 7.7 °C (13.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 18.6 °C (33.5°F) less in Carolina.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1126.8 mm (44.4 in) more which is equivalent to 1126.8 l/m² (27.65 US gal/ft²) or 11,268,000 l/ha (1,204,624 US gal/ac) more. About 3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.4° higher in Carolina than in Ballinger, Tx.
